About Seapoint
Seapoint at Monkstown is a historic Blue Flag bathing place on the south Dublin coast, a flat, sheltered swimming spot beside a Martello tower rather than a sandy beach. Lifeguarded in summer and beloved by Dublin's sea swimmers year-round, it has slipways, showers and changing facilities. There is no car park, but it is a short walk from Salthill & Monkstown DART station.
